On Thursday March 11, 2010 join Canada in taking one big bite towards healthy living through healthy eating. The "Great Big Crunch" invites all communities to learn about healthy eating and local and global food systems while following the journey from the apple seed, to the harvest, to the market, to the core. Croft will be supporting this initiative by providing free apples to all students on Thursday March 11th. Help support healthier children by promoting healthy eating habits each and every day.

The Winter Olympics are fast approaching and Canada is getting ready. At Croft, two weeks of Olympic events are being planned to help celebrate the Vancouver 2010 Games.   The “Croft 2010 Olympics” will begin on February 12th with an Opening Ceremony at the front of our school. This will be followed by two weeks of sporting competitions and a Closing Ceremony on February 26th.
